WebFigure 4.2 (a) Most light microscopes in a college biology lab can magnify cells up to approximately 400 times and have a resolution of about 200 nanometers. (b) Electron microscopes provide a much higher magnification, 100,000x, and have a resolution of 50 picometers. Web24 jun. 2024 · Electron microscopy was invented in 1931 by a team of 2 German scientists, Ernst Ruska and Max Knoll.
